Apple To Launch New Mac Minis and Pros This Summer
According to our reliable sources, Apple is all set to launch their all new Mac Pros and Mac Minis this summer. Sources tell that the new Mac Minis and Mac Pros will be loaded with more Intel hardware.
It’s said that the new computers will be having the all new Sandy Bridge processor architecture Intel and will be entering the market at the starting of August. The new Mac Minis and Mac Pros will also be having Thunderbolt data ports, Mac OS X Lion and high-speed connector technology of Intel, tells our sources.
We don’t know whether the gadgets will be seeing any cosmetic changes or not, and neither have we got any information regarding the configurations and specifications in which the new systems will be launched.
